Mobile phone and social media networks are generating a massive amount of datasets that contain human social interacting activities and mobility information. Cell phones and mobile networks can consider as digital footprints of the people under mobile sensing technology. This paper aims to present a method to classify land use types based on mobile call activities computed from Call Detail Records (CDRs). In this paper, mobile calls are aggregated by Base Transceiver Station (BTS) at one-hour intervals and clustered using kmeans clustering method. According to clustering method, four land use types in eight clusters are generated, named as industrial areas, mixed land use areas, residential in urbanized area and periphery area. The development of land use map was validated with map of Japan International Cooperation Agency (JICA) survey. This map will help to urban and city planners to build a sustainable urban environment as a case of Yangon City.
